Description

Nextcloud guests app is a utility to create guest users which can only see files shared with them. In affected versions users could change the allowed list of apps, allowing them to use apps that were not intended to be used. It is recommended that the Guests app is upgraded to 2.4.1, 2.5.1 or 3.0.1.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.
